Duties and Responsibilities

  • Provide guidance to managers on employee relations issues, performance management, conflict resolution, and policy interpretation
  • Conduct fair, timely investigations and support documentation requirements
  • Coach managers on effective communication and team engagement
  • Aid in annual compensation reviews, job leveling, benchmarking, and pay equity checks
  • Maintain accurate employee data and support HRIS workflows
  • Produce reports and dashboards (headcount, turnover, engagement, talent metrics)
  • Interpret data and present insights that help managers make informed decisions
  • Support the performance review cycle, goal setting, and development planning
  • Partner with leaders on workforce planning, succession planning, and talent assessments
  • Identify skill gaps and collaborate on training and development solutions
  • Partner with managers to improve engagement, recognition, communication, and team culture
  • Support action plans following engagement surveys
  • Promote inclusion and consistency in HR practices
  • Identify opportunities to enhance HR processes and employee experience
  • Maintain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), documentation, workflows, and standardization
  • Support HR initiatives, policy updates, HRIS improvements, and organizational change projects
  • Ensure employment practices comply with applicable laws and company policies
  • Support audits and maintain proper employee records
  • Aid in policy development and rollout

Required Experience, Education, Skills, and Abilities for Consideration as a Candidate

  • Bachelor’s degree in human resources, business, or related field
  • 5+ years of HR generalist or HRBP experience
  • Strong understanding of employee relations, talent management, compensation basics, and HR operations
  • Intermediate to expert-level experience with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int
  • Thorough knowledge of employment-related laws and regulations
  • Experience with HRIS platforms and HR reporting tools
  • Excellent communication, coaching, and problem-solving skills
  • Ability to influence without authority and build trusted relationships
  • Data-driven mindset with strong attention to detail

Preferred or Additional, Experience, Education, Skills and Abilities

  • SHRM-CP Certification
  • Experience working in the automotive industry
  • Experience working in a manufacturing environment
